AI Contract Overview
The contract entails providing on-call maintenance and repair services for Royal Saudi Airforce C-130H aircraft operating within North America, including the continental United States, Canada, Azores, Bermuda, and the Bahamas. The performance period is structured for four years, beginning with a one-year base period followed by three one-year option periods. The contractor is required to establish a 24/7 call center to support scheduled flight missions, enabling the RSAF flight crew or the AFLCMC/WLNI Program Office to request repairs during flights. Upon notification, the contractor must respond within 12 hours to dispatch a repair team to address the maintenance needs. This effort will be conducted under full and open competition, with the solicitation expected to be released on July 27, 2020, and proposals due by August 27, 2020. The request for proposal will be available exclusively through the beta.SAM.gov website, with no paper copies or telephone inquiries accepted. The contract specifics highlight that configuration control of the C-130 aircraft remains with Saudi Arabia, and technical manuals accompany the aircraft during travel, facilitating effective repair services. All correspondence and questions related to the solicitation are to be submitted in writing to designated points of contact at the Air Force Life Cycle Management Center located at Robins Air Force Base, Georgia.
